I have a new client who has between 500 and 1000 articles in MS Word format.
He wants to put them on a website.

1 Is there a utility to convert these into a usable HTML format
automatically?  Even if I were to hire a data entry person to convert by
hand via MS Word's Save As Web Page feature, I am then only going to want
the BODY of the thing because I want to build the CSS myself.  Hmmm--I also
don't know if the articles are full of formatting or not which I may have to
remove.  I do know someone who runs a fairly large site with a
constantly-growing database of articles, and he puts new articles on the
site via a secretary who cuts and pastes from MS Word into a private, online
data-entry web page--this is an option but seems somewhat low tech.  Any
ideas are appreciated.

2 Is there a pre-fab CMS which would be appropriate for such a site?  He
does have the articles broken down into categories and subcategories, so I
suppose it's actually only a matter of a small database, but I don't know if
he plans to update the articles or to add a lot.  The client is brand-new to
the internet and doesn't know quite what he wants for this site just yet.
